konstifik
03-31-2017, 09:46 AM
I have never even seen one being used in PVP so that might be a guide to how good he is?

I've seen tons of PDK's in PvP, but not in any higher ranked teams. His passive cleanse is annoying, but his damage is so low that you can leave him alive until last.

The increased chance of triggering Curse is probably the best improvement from sharding him. Still, the AI is too stupid for him to be effective in a defending team.

Kardas
06-03-2017, 02:07 PM
Depends on what your team is. For most PVP-oriented characters I give them a Health set (I would use Shell Talismans but alas I have none) and fill the rest with offense Talismans.
I haven't used my (Sharded) PDK in forever, but I'll expect he'll do just fine with 2 Shells (Ward) and 4 Paladin (3 Power 1 Arcane).
Another niche option is giving him a Comet set along with the usual 2 greens. PDK should be tanky enough to cope with the lack of health granted by the Comet set.
